Is it worth visiting the North Shore of Oahu?
Yes — the North Shore of Oahu is one of Hawaii's most rewarding day trips and requires no paid tours. The 30-mile stretch from Haleiwa to Turtle Bay offers world-famous surf breaks, roadside shrimp trucks, Matsumoto's shave ice, and Waimea Bay's cliff jumping in summer. Between November and February, it hosts the Triple Crown of Surfing — the world's premier big wave competition, drawing 30-foot waves and free to watch from the beach. Haleiwa town itself has boutique shops, plate lunch spots, and a laid-back surf culture that contrasts sharply with Waikiki's resort strip. Drive it in a rental car, stop wherever looks good, and allow a full day. Combine with snorkeling at Sharks Cove in summer for a complete North Shore experience.
